Vienna, Austria, stands out as a unique wine city, rivaling the global giants of London and Paris. Meanwhile, Wine Enthusiast’s 2024 Wine Region of the Year award highlights Mendocino County’s commitment to sustainability, urging wine lovers to look beyond Napa and explore the region’s distinct offerings in Anderson Valley.

Ste. Michelle Wine Estates debuts Chateau Ste. Michelle LIGHT, a lighter Chardonnay and Sauvignon Blanc tailored for health-conscious consumers, showcasing reduced sugar levels and lower alcohol content while maintaining the quality of Washington state grapes. Ram’s Gate Winery’s surprising acquisition by O’Neill Vintners & Distillers signals a bold move into the luxury wine market, reflecting broader industry trends towards high-end and sustainable wine production.
